Random library reading. Exactly the lighthearted, predictable and sweetly romantic story I wanted. A quick read since the story was fun enough to keep me turning pages. The non-stop awkward similes started to bother me towards the end, but other than that I enjoyed the writing style as well.

My only real criticism is all the stuff about Zoe's weight. Several people comment on it (or her eating) and she herself thinks about it a lot. Yet this "plot" about her weight never really goes anywhere. There's no revelation or discovery for Zoe or anyone else. In the end I wonder why the whole thing was even mentioned. Now it's pretty much just "girl gains weight, then loses some - people comment on it". I was hoping for a realization that her weight doesn't define her worth or something like that, but there's nothing. Why is this even in the book?

Although this book had potential with the trope it opened up, it sadly didn't withstand to its potential.
I felt like there were not enough perspectives from other characters which would of broadened up the horizons for the audience as this book was far to vague, and yet at the same time managed to be far too descriptive in other areas.

I deeply disliked the fact that there were scenes which didn't add to the book as they were out of the blue with random newly introduced characters which we never see nor explore again, these scenes were also cut short which made this book sound much more like a diary than a balanced story as it had no depth within it.

Although the character of Ryan seemed to be the saving grace at the beginning, by the end it felt like he had no personality as it changed from one end of the extreme to the next.
There was no subtlety in any of the changes nor were they ones which would have suited his character which was quite disappointing as if the calm cold collective personality was stuck to then the relationship would have seemed more interesting with more smaller changes as it gives a slower yet much more interesting pase. Then again there were so little pages exploring their relationship by the end of it I wasn't invested in the slightest. I just wanted to finish this book and have it over and done with.

Overall it wasnt a bad read but I am critical as it could have been a much better with slight changes.
